CLOSED THROTTLE OR IDLE ADJUSTMENT – PEDAL-START VEHICLES
When the accelerator pedal is released, the engine will stop. Therefore, it is not possible to measure or set idling
speed under normal vehicle operating conditions. Set throttle valve as follows:
1.
Loosen the throttle body idle screw so that it is not touching the throttle lever (Figure 23-11, Page 23-12).
2.
Slowly tighten the idle screw until it lightly touches the throttle lever, then tighten it an additional 1 whole turn
(360 degrees).

CLOSED THROTTLE OR IDLE ADJUSTMENT – KEY-START VEHICLES
Adjust the idle screw until idle RPM is 1200 (±25) (Figure 23-11, Page 23-12).
